The Bureau of Internal Revenue temporarily suspends all its field audits and related operations.
03:00
This following calls to investigate an alleged extortion scheme within the agency.
03:05
BIR Commissioner Charlie Mendoza says the suspension covers the issuance of letters of authority and
03:11
mission orders. LOAs are formal documents that authorize BIR revenue officers to examine a
03:17
taxpayer's books of accounts and records for a designated period. Meanwhile, MOs authorize revenue
03:23
officers to conduct surveillance and inventory-taking activities on business operations.
03:27
Mendoza describes the suspension as a necessary move to protect taxpayers and strengthen the
03:33
BIR's internal processes. The suspension comes just hours after Senator Irwin Tulfo filed the Senate
03:39
resolution directing the Blue Ribbon Committee to probe the alleged extortion scheme. While Tulfo
03:44
welcomes the BIR's suspension, he said the involved tax officials and personnel must still be held
03:49

The Cebugay Wetland Nature Reserve has been named the newest East Asian Australasian Flyway
04:42
Partnership Flyway Network site. This recognition places Zamwanga, Cebugay Province at the forefront of
04:48
international migratory bird conservation. Flyway network sites are globally recognized critical
04:54
habitats for millions of migratory birds traveling along the East Asian Australasian Flyway. It is one of
05:01
the most threatened biodiverse flyways in the world. Zamwanga, Cebugay, Governor Anhofer says, the
05:07
conferment opens doors for better local conservation and sustainable ecotourism initiatives.
05:12
Only wetlands that meet strict ecological criteria, such as supporting rare endangered migratory species, are
05:19
admitted into the network. Before this recognition, the area was designated as a Ramsar site, which means it's covered by
05:26
the Ramsar Convention, an international treaty for the conservation and sustainable use of wetlands.
